Yamaha Motor to Establish New Company employing Persons with Disabilities

July 1, 2015

IWATA, July 1, 2015 – Yamaha Motor Co., Ltd. (Tokyo: 7272) announced today that they will establish a new company, Yamaha Motor MIRAI Co., LTD. on October 1, 2015, aimed at promoting social independence and providing a place where those with disabilities can participate actively according to their capacity.

To date, the company has arranged its work environment to employ persons with disabilities in a variety of occupations under the stance of enabling persons with and without disabilities to work side by side.

The new company will help to support social independence by developing each employee’s abilities, and will work to boost employment by providing a workplace where even greater numbers of persons with mental and other disabilities can express their individual potential.

Operation of the new company is scheduled to begin in April 2016, and will commence with parts packaging and facility cleaning work, followed by gradual expansion into other types of work.

After launch, the new company intends to apply for certification as a "special subsidiary company"* based on the "Act on Employment Promotion etc. of Persons with Disabilities".


*Special subsidiary company system:
Under the special subsidiary system, if an enterprise forms a subsidiary that gives special consideration to employees in order to promote and stabilize the employment of persons with disabilities, and with the condition that the subsidiary is certified by the Minister of Health, Labour and Welfare as satisfying certain requirements, those who are employed at the subsidiary are deemed to be employed at the parent company and by the group as a whole.

New Company Outline (Proposed)

Company Name Yamaha Motor MIRAI Co., Ltd.
Location Shingai 2500, Iwata-shi, Shizuoka, Japan
(within Yamaha Motor HQ)
Date of establishment October 1, 2015 (Scheduled to begin operation in April 2016)
Business description Parts packing, cleaning
No. of Employees 27 (Estimated no. at business start)
Capital 20 million yen (Yamaha Motor 100% Investment)
